GOLDBLATT v. STATE


72 A.D.2d 886 (1979)

Jacob Goldblatt et al., Appellants, v. State of New York, Respondent. (Claim No. 60120.)

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Third Department.

November 29, 1979


The claimant, Jacob Goldblatt, was injured on October 16, 1975 when he attempted to ride his bicycle from the shoulder of United States Route 6, a State highway, onto the traveled portion of the road. He testified to the effect that as his bicycle approached the roadway surface, he looked down and saw a depression in the surface, which the front wheel of his bicycle hit, causing him to fall and suffer personal injuries.
